H018092 OFFICER'S M43/MOUNTAIN FIELD CAP. (Einheitsfeldmütze M43/Bergmütze)

BACKGROUND: The Mountain cap was originally introduced in the early 1930's, and based on the caps worn by Austrian Mountain troops in WWI. The cap was designed for wear by Mountain, Ski and Jäger personnel. From its inception the Bergmütze had no readily identifiable rank indicator although the buttons were to be silver for Officer’s and gilt for General Officer’s. Regulations of October 1942 introduced silver/aluminum or gold piping to the top crown edge as a rank indicator. Although very similar to the M43, these Bergmütze where issued in considerably smaller quantities and are more scarce.

PHYSICAL DESCRIPTION: Nice quality field-grey wool construction cap features fold down back and side panels with a downward scalloped front edge and forward sides and two small mid-brown molded bakelite buttons. The back and side panels were designed to be folded down to protect the wearers ears and neck and the scalloped front section could be secured with the buttons closed under the wearers chin. The top crown edge is piped in bright, interwoven, silver/aluminum braiding. The front center of the cap has a machine woven national eagle in bright, silver/aluminum flat-wire threads and a national tri-color cockade in black, bright, silver/aluminum flat-wire and red threads, both mounted on a woven, blue/green, "T" shaped, rayon base. The insignia is machine stitched to the cap. Left side panel of cap has a 1939 pattern, silver washed, stamped alloy edelweiss with nine petals, two leaves, single stem and separate, gilt washed, stamen attached by two bent over prongs. Edelweiss has four small holes in the flower and one in the stem for stitching it to the cap. The cap has an extended, cloth covered, forward, visor with an internal stiffener with a subtly raised lip to the top of the forward edge and a single row of reinforcement stitching to the bottom of the forward edge.
